## Signing the Lintbase Baseline

The static-analysis baseline file for Quarrel CI (`baseline.lint.json`) must be signed before every deploy, or the Harkwell gate rejects the build. On-call: if the gate fails at 03:00, regenerate the baseline with `quarrel lint --freeze`, then re-sign it. Do not skip the gate; unsigned baselines let suppressed findings drift silently. The signing key currently in rotation is below.

signing key of bagap-yawep = bky13_TbfT6ZMUoGJo2

**Ticket: Import wizard failing on staging**

The Quillhaven CSV import wizard returns a 401 on every upload in the staging environment. Root cause: the env file was copied from the sandbox tier and is missing the ingest credential, so the wizard can't authenticate against the parser service. No code change needed. To resolve, open the staging .env and add the following line at the end.

vault entry, kaduf-yahaf: LEDGER_TOKEN13=ce3a195753e1b

Hey Priya — quick handover before I'm off. The quiet room on the top floor of Marwick House is finally back in service after the aircon fix. Bookings go through the usual sheet; cap it at two hours so nobody camps in there. Cleaners come Thursdays, so block that morning. The door keypad was reset yesterday — the new entry code is below.

staff pass of kawip-hawef = bdg-QLP-2

Briefing — Leadership Review: Coppervale Retail Pilot. Twelve Coppervale stores carried the Lumen range for eight weeks. Sell-through hit 68%, above the 55% threshold. Returns negligible. Coppervale wants expansion to forty stores with co-branded displays; they'll fund half the fixtures. Ops can supply at that scale by Q2. Recommendation: proceed, pending margin check. The incoming director should note the plan detail directly below.

board note of taguf-fahif: The eastern region missed its Giliel quota by 53.9 percent last quarter. Fraethax Systems plans to lower the Istion list price by 42.7 percent in June. The steering committee signed off on a budget of $143.5 million for Project Zorok. The renewal with Zormirax Logistics closes at $421.4 million a year, 47.2 percent below the last contract.